This makes this plugin very easy to use and also very easy to bind with database. To learn more, see our tips on writing great answers. Forentity framework configurationrefer below article. Then add each subject id into the long type List name subjectsIds, and pass this subjectsIds into the model by casting it with ToArray(). The JavaScript MultiSelect Dropdown is a quick replacement for the HTML select tag for selecting multiple values. Can a county without an HOA or Covenants stop people from storing campers or building sheds? Multiple-selection is animportant part of drop-down UI component as it improves the user interactivity with the website in order to allow the user to make his/her choice first and then send the request to the server for batch processing instead of again and again sending a request to the server for same choice selection. Also shown is how the contents of one . $ ( 'select [multiple]' ).multiselect (); jQuery MultiSelect plugin provides various options to customize and enhance the multi-select dropdown functionality. It will fell like it is a dropdown list with checkbox. Here, I have created integer type list property which will capture my multiple selection values from the Razor View drop-down control and country object type list property which will display my multiple-selection choice in a table after processing on the server via ASP.NET MVC5 platform. Table 1 - Teacher ( holds teacher information) Table 2-Subjects (holds all subjects) I would like to use the asp.net mvc multiselect dropdown with checkbox. This behaviour is really a feature of MVC, where selection of which particular action to execute on a controller can . Here, I am going to create a teacher example, where I create a teacher with their name and multiple subjects and save them into the database, display the teacher list and edit each teacher with their subject list. CSHTML GameList.cs Let's break down each method and try to understand what have we added here. Basic knowledge of Entity Framework. If you have any confusion regarding these topics, you can download the project. Trying to match up a new seat for my bicycle and having difficulty finding one that will work. . Everything is working perfect . The prefix multi means "many;" today we will multi ply your vocabulary "many" times over by introducing you to the english prefix multi ! Why are there two different pronunciations for the word Tee? Introduction. When the Form is submitted, the posted values are captured through the, > selectedItems = fruit.Fruits.Where(p => fruit.FruitIds.Contains(, Inside the jQuery document ready event handler, the. I have also created the display list which will display the list of multiple countries as the user makes multiple selection choices via bootstrap style drop-down plugin and finally, I have also linked the require reference libraries for bootstrap style plugin.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Step 4: Go to your " HomeController.cs " and create the SelectList item in your " Index ActionMethod " to bind it with dropdown Helper in Razor View. I used browser dev tool and it said Failed to load resource: the server responded with a status of 404 (Not Found) BsMultiSelect.js. I hope, you enjoyed this article and learned lots of things. The following example does not use a layout page and file references are to CDNs. Example of CheckBox in ASP.NET MVC MultiSelect Dropdown Control. The comment is now awaiting moderation. You can download the complete source code for this tutorial or you can follow the step by step discussion below. user wants checkbox inside of dropdown so that can check the option. Before calling this method I have also set the live search property of the plugin, so, the end-user can search for the requiredvalue from the dropdown list. ///Multiselectdropdownviewmodelclass. Use the code, given below-, You can see and understand the complete code, given below-, Now, run the Application and see the output, as shown below-, Congratulations - C# Corner Q4, 2022 MVPs Announced, How to use script or CDN in MVC Application. the select list contains the single options as checkboxes. MutliSelectDropdownwithcheckbox.zip Introduction In this article, I am going to explain about how to bind the value to dropdown from the database and how to implement dropdown multiselect with checkboxlist, using jQuery multiselect plugin. Responsive Multiselect built with Bootstrap 5. This article will show you how you can create a jquery multiselect dropdown list with checkboxes for multiple select dropdown with checkboxes in asp.net mvc application. How can I upload files asynchronously with jQuery? "height:100px;overflow:auto;border:solid;width:150px;". . I did a quick Google Search: asp.net mvc multiselect dropdown - Google Search [ ^] Found many examples like this one: ASP.NET MVC 5 - Bootstrap Style Multi Select Dropdown Plugin [ ^ ]. An adverb which means "doing without understanding". This sample demonstrates the checkbox functionalities of the MultiSelect. To actualize a Multiple Select (MultiSelect) DropDownList with CheckBoxes in ASP.NET, we should make use of ListBox control and apply jQuery Bootstrap Multi-Select Plugin to it. Any help would be greatly appreciated. Along with this, I'll show you how you maintain a database for this type of data and display a list of data. How Intuit improves security, latency, and development velocity with a Site Maintenance - Friday, January 20, 2023 02:00 - 05:00 UTC (Thursday, Jan Were bringing advertisements for technology courses to Stack Overflow. Checkbox in ASP.NET MVC Multi Select Control | Syncfusion CheckBox in MultiSelect Control 26 Oct 2022 12 minutes to read The MultiSelect has built-in support to select multiple values through checkbox, when mode property set as CheckBox. ASP .Net MVC Web Application integrating bootstrap templates; How to insert line break in bootstrap alert -bootstrap MVC; How can i use the bootstrap dropdowns and alerts instead of the @Html.DropDownList & alert for my asp.net MVC; Incorrect aligning of form controls in ASP MVC 5 and Bootstrap Why does awk -F work for most letters, but not for the letter "t"? Leave the authentication type as "No Authentication." I've also chosen to uncheck the "Configure for HTTPS" checkbox, because I'm not planning on deploying this example project later. Everything is working perfect . Please refer, Download Bootstrap and jQuery Bootstrap Multi-Select Plugin. How do I refresh a page using JavaScript? It will fell like it is a dropdown list with checkbox. I am using bootstrap v3 @Html.ListBoxFor(m => Model.DepDashTaskLists[i]. Go to File > New > Project > Web > Asp.net MVCweb project > Enter Application Name > Selectyour project location > click to OK button > It will show new dialog window for selecttemplate > here we will selectMVCproject > then click to ok Step3: Add Connection string on the web.config file. In the above method, I am simply loading my sample country list data extract from the ".txt" file into an in-memory list of type "CountryObj". Create Checkbox in ASP.NET MVC. You are not following the recommendations. Now create a HttpPost method for submitting and updating teachers with the database. How Could One Calculate the Crit Chance in 13th Age for a Monk with Ki in Anydice? Here, I create an additional link button for adding a teacher and render an edit link with each teacher. MVC4 DropDownList I need a way to set already selected values in a multi select dropdown in a edit view in a web application (ASP.NET, Mvc) from view code,I passed selected ids in to selected values array. So how to implement it in razor page in core. . Making statements based on opinion; back them up with references or personal experience.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Find centralized, trusted content and collaborate around the technologies you use most. I have also created GET & POST "Index()" methods for request & response purpose. @Curious-programmer: You don't use _Layout for this form? To implement a Multiple Select (MultiSelect) DropDownList with CheckBoxes in . MultiSelect Dropdown with check box example MultiSelect Dropdown with check box documentation Selection limit You can limit the number of items that can be selected in a drop-down. //Copyright(c)Allowtodistributethiscodeandutilizethiscodeforpersonalorcommercialpurpose. Christian Science Monitor: a socially acceptable source among conservative Christians? This article is about integration of the Bootsrtap CSS style dropdown with enabling of multi selection choice by using Bootstrap Select plugin into ASP.NET MVC5 platform. Listbox element will be used for building the bootstrap multiple select (multi select) dropdownlist with checkboxes by making use of bootstrap and the jquery bootstrap multi select plugin. #regionGet:/MultiSelectDropDown/Indexmethod. Unlike a standard Select , multiselect allows the user to select multiple options at once. How to add a jQuery dialog to add new categories. Why did OpenSSH create its own key format, and not use PKCS#8? In the above lines of code, the text values i.e. },StringSplitOptions.RemoveEmptyEntries); /*Insidestringtypesvariableshouldcontainitemsvalues*/, Congratulations - C# Corner Q4, 2022 MVPs Announced, Filling Dropdown List (Html Select List) Dynamically Using ASP.NET MVC and JQuery Ajax, A Tool To Generate PySpark Schema From JSON, Implementation Of ChatGPT In Power Automate, How To Change Status Bar Color In .NET MAUI, How To Create SharePoint Site Group Permission. How can I add checkboxes in the simplest way ? You can follow the simple steps, given below, to implement a Multiple Select DropdownList with CheckBox. In this asp .net tutorial we will learn about how to create dropdownlist with checkboxes in asp .net with demo and sample code download. You can add your comment about this article using the form below. How can I select an element with multiple classes in jQuery? Youll be auto redirected in 1 second. In the above method, I have converted my data list into the type that is acceptable by the Razor View Engine drop-down control. Create a new ASP.NET Core solution and call it CheckBox. How could magic slowly be destroying the world? I used your code and it show only dropdown without check box for each email. Open the browsers dev tools (F12) and look for error in the console and network tab. Just like below. Razor offers two ways to generate select lists: the select tag helper and the DropDownList (and DropDownListFor) Html Helpers, which are artefacts inherited from pre-ASP.NET Core versions of the MVC framework. Can state or city police officers enforce the FCC regulations? The MultiSelect control is one of the many Telerik UI for ASP.NET MVC components with support for RTL configuration. There is a fantastic JQuery Plugin called Dropdown Check List that transforms a regular select HTML element into a dropdown checkbox list. The HTML MultiSelect Dropdown is a textbox component that allows the user to type or select multiple values from a list of predefined options. if the count of selected items is greater than 3 it should be displayed the count of selected items in the drop down. Our checkbox, in the interface, will represent whether the file has been backed up or not. If this is not suitable, there are many more to choose from. Some mostly used multi-select dropdown example code snippets are given below. Please read my last post! your smart developer indeed. @Curious-programmer: Add @Html.AntiForgeryToken() inside Form. Bootstrap Multiselect. We are creating a dropdown list that looks like this: Prepare the database for this holding this type of data, create 3 tables. Do peer-reviewers ignore details in complicated mathematical computations and theorems? There is a fantastic JQuery Plugin called Dropdown Check List that transforms a regular select HTML element into a dropdown checkbox list. Double-sided tape maybe? This guide will only focus on the tag helper. The ASP.NET MVC MultiSelect Dropdown control has check box support. Download FREE API for Word, Excel and PDF in ASP.Net: This site is started with intent to serve the ASP.Net Community by providing forums (question-answer) site where people can help each other. To use checkbox, inject the CheckBoxSelection module in the MultiSelect. Add HTML/ Razor control to creating dropdown. CheckBox. jQuery-ui: enabling disabled button doesn't restore event. To overcome this, we created a multiselect dropdown with checkboxes to use a dropdown like a feature that can select multiple values. In this article, I will explain how to implement a Multiple Select (MultiSelect) DropDownList with CheckBoxes in ASP.NET with jQuery Bootstrap Multi-Select Plugin. The Zone of Truth spell and a politics-and-deception-heavy campaign, how could they co-exist? How to troubleshoot crashes detected by Google Play Store for Flutter app, Cupertino DateTime picker interfering with scroll behaviour. Find centralized, trusted content and collaborate around the technologies you use most. This link has checkboxes with in the dropdownlist,i hope this link is best suitable for your question. public class Student { public int StudentId { get; set; } [Display . In the above code, I have mapped the dropdown list data into a view bag property, which will be used in Razor View control and done some basic initialization of my attached view model to the UI view. Browser debug too say Email:53 Uncaught TypeError: $().bsMultiSelect is not a function. By Peter Vogel 06/09/2017 How to use the DropDownList helper to select category data. Connect and share knowledge within a single location that is structured and easy to search. The multiple attribute of the DropDownList is set which enables multiple selections. How to add jQueryUI library in MVC 5 project? how to validate the request using onBegin in Ajax.Begin Form? The sample code is being developed in Microsoft Visual Studio 2015 Enterprise. f you are a beginner in ASP.NET MVC and jQuery, I am listing some important links to learn-. Here's the code snippet: <div id="divStudentlist" style="height: 100px; overflow: auto; border: solid; width: 150px;"> @foreach (var items in ViewData ["Items"] as List When the Submit Button is clicked, the Form gets submitted and multiple selected CustomerId values are sent to the Razor PageModel. Afterwards, add jQuery Plugins or CDN, as shown below-, "http://ajax.googleapis.com/ajax/libs/jquery/1.8.3/jquery.min.js", "http://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.0.3/css/bootstrap.min.css", "http://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.0.3/js/bootstrap.min.js", "http://cdn.rawgit.com/davidstutz/bootstrap-multiselect/master/dist/css/bootstrap-multiselect.css", "http://cdn.rawgit.com/davidstutz/bootstrap-multiselect/master/dist/js/bootstrap-multiselect.js", write JS code to implement multiselect with Checkbox in Dropdown. for instance, in math class you learned about the operation multi plication, or the . 2023 C# Corner. Search for jobs related to Multiselect dropdown with checkbox in mvc 4 razor or hire on the world's largest freelancing marketplace with 22m+ jobs. javascript/jquery modal popup dialog MVC 4 / render partial view. In the above code, I have created my view model which I will attach with my view. Enabling a check box on each item helps the user handle multiple selected values. How do you handle multiple submit buttons in ASP.NET MVC Framework? MVCMultiSelectDropDown.zip Multiple-selection is an important part of drop-down UI component as it improves the user interactivity with the website in order to allow the user to make his/her choice first and then send the request to the server for batch processing instead of again and again sending a request to the server for same choice selection. You said there were no errors. This guide presents a couple of common ways to populate dropdown lists in ASP.NET MVC Razor views, with an emphasis on producing functional HTML forms with a minimum amount of code. Allows the users visitor to select multiple options from a drop down list. All contents are copyright of their authors. Wall shelves, hooks, other wall-mounted things, without drilling? Click the MultiSelect element and then type a character in the search box. Thanks for contributing an answer to Stack Overflow! Getting Started Start by downloading the starter project with the following link, Download. I tested my code and it shows checkboxes perfectly. I am creating a MVC Application and creating controller ", the next step, create an Action to open the view ", In this article, I am using hard code value, but you can bind from the database. Asp.net MVC 5 - Select data based on dropdownlist selected item in Asp.net MVC 5 Asp.net MVC 5Entity Framework 6 . Database How do I check whether a checkbox is checked in jQuery? ///Getsorsetschoosemultiplecountriesproperty. You will need to download the plugin files from the following location. Synchronization instructions are the same for every selection mode. In the above code, I have populated & mapped the selected countries list into my model and then pass the Model back to the View. Documentation, Examples, FAQ and License: https://davidstutz . Now, execute the project and you will be able to see the bootstrap style multi-select dropdown plugin in action, as shown below. note: for beginners in using ado.net with asp.net mvc, please refer my article asp.net mvc: ado.net tutorial with example. Were sorry. How to add Date Picker Bootstrap 3 on MVC 5 project using the Razor engine? Anyway, below is a working and tested example. is ListBoxFor and I want every time when user click on the text area on listboxfor it will show dropdowm menu for list of users email. In this article, we are going to see how to bind the value to dropdown and configure the multiselect checkboxlist with dropdown, using jQuery. The HtmlHelper class includes two extension methods to generate a <input type="checkbox"> HTML control in a razor view: CheckBox () and CheckBoxFor (). Step 2: Inside View write foreach loop for multiselect dropdown with checkboxlist. Step 3: Create a View Model Class in your projects "Models" folders, right click on "Models" folder, select "Add" and then select "Class", give it a name "DropdownViewModel.cs" and click "Add". Finally the multiple selected Fruit names are displayed using JavaScript Alert Message Box. Thank you so much, your last code work perfect to me, I will learn more about CSS and JS You can check this brief demo: Here is the tutorial link, more details in it: https://www.jqueryscript.net/form/Bootstrap-4-Multi-Select-BsMultiSelect.html. All contents are copyright of their authors. Additionally using a filter, enableFiltering set to true. Here is the Add Teacher view for adding a teacher: In the above article, we learn to create and edit a multi-select checkbox dropdown list in ASP.NET Core 3.1 MVC, and adding a boostrap-multiselect CSS and JS for displaying the layout of this dropdown. I am working on MVC4 project where i have a multi select dropdown, Its populated with list of years i have mentioned in controller, and on dropdown click i am calling jquery to select that particular value and also when page is loaded i checking values saved in database by making them select by default, Here is jquery code to selected the values which are saved in database, and here is code i am using to select the value when user clicks or press ctrl key on dropdown values. I think you'll be interested in learning CSS and JS file references. For radio buttons, the type is "radio ": <input type="checkbox" /> <input type="radio" />. The below lines of code have enabled the multiple-selection in bootstrap style dropdown Razor View UI component. MultiSelect Dropdown. In the above code, I have simply created a basic default layout page and linked the require libraries into it. Here in this example, I have used an angular directive angularjs-dropdown-multiselect, this directive gives us a Bootstrap Dropdown with the power of AngularJS directives. All contents are copyright of their authors. Did you add a reference to the bootstrap-multiselect.css file in the _AdminMasterLayout.cshtml layout page? I found many articles show only when click on the button and then show the dropdown menu with check box, what I have The content posted here is free for public and is the content of its poster. selected items should be displayed in the drop down as a comma separated string. For checkboxes, the type attribute must be "checkbox". 2 After this, include the Bootstrap multiselect's CSS and JavaScript file to your page. Select to create multiselect dropdown. Again, you are doing something wrong. namespaceDropdownMulitSelectCheckbox.Controllers{, "http://code.jquery.com/jquery-1.12.4.min.js", "http://cdn.rawgit.com/davidstutz/bootstrap-multiselect/master/dist/css/bootstrap-multiselect.css", "http://cdn.rawgit.com/davidstutz/bootstrap-multiselect/master/dist/js/bootstrap-multiselect.js", "http://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.0.3/css/bootstrap.min.css", "http://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.0.3/js/bootstrap.min.js", });
multiselect dropdown with checkbox in mvc 5 razor
Currie Graham Looks Like Kevin Spacey,
Charentais Cantaloupe Skin Care,
Mobile Homes For Rent Mcdowell County, Nc,
Articles M